Vitamin B12 Deficiency in vegetarians: 3 important facts, and how to fix it

Vitamin B12 deficiency can have effects on both mental and physical health. Low levels of B12 can reduce oxygen transport, as it is essential for red blood cell production. Long-term deficiency can even cause irreversible nerve damage. Vegetarians and vegans are particularly vulnerable to this deficiency. Here we mention 3 important facts about vitamin B12…
